Black Orc models from the Fantasy range are about the size of a 40k Ork Nob....so I'd say are probably a tad small for a Warboss.

JSK-Fox wrote:What if I were to beef him up a bit, make him a li'l taller, etc.

At that point you might as well just get the Black Reach boss and convert him up with plasticard or something.
Black Orcs are the right size for Nobz as previously stated, but nowhere near big enough for a boss.
